Introversion and Stress And Anxiety Are Not alike

But very first, a disclaimer, because you’re reading web site about introversion:

Never assume all introverts knowledge stress and anxiety, and yes, extroverts and ambiverts may have it, as well. Introversion and anxieties aren’t the same; introversion is defined as a preference for calm, minimally stimulating conditions, whereas anxiousness are an over-all name for psychological state problems that create extortionate anxiety, concern, and stress.

Nevertheless, for a lot of introverts, anxiety are an everyday (and unwanted) part of her life: According to Dr. Laurie Helgoe, it is statistically usual in introverts than extroverts.

Understanding High-Functioning Anxiousness?

The primary reason high-functioning stress and anxiety is really sneaky are people who enjoy they rarely when reveal some of the common anxiety evidence. Outwardly, they are maintaining they along, plus they may even lead extremely profitable, high-profile lives. Nobody is able to tell from external that they’re pushed by concern, as well as in fact, they could not see the genuine roots of one’s own actions.

High-functioning anxiousness just isn’t the state medical diagnosis, but it’s things a lot of people diagnose with, and something extra therapists are starting to fairly share the help of its clients. It’s probably more closely associated with general panic, which has an effect on 6.8 million people from inside the U.S., people being twice as expected to understanding it as boys.

2. maybe you are freaking on the interior, but you are stoic on the exterior.

People who have high-functioning anxiety don’t program exactly how anxious these include. They might look completely peaceful and collectively even though a violent storm of worry was raging internally; they have discovered to compartmentalize their unique thoughts. This will be one other reason high-functioning stress and anxiety is called a secret anxiety.

3. You can see worldwide in a fundamentally different method.

While you might question their anxieties and second-guess your self, how you feel are not “just in your head.” Researchers through the Weizmann Institute of Science in Israel discovered that people who find themselves stressed really look at industry in another way than those people who aren’t anxious. Within the research, nervous individuals were less in a position to distinguish between a secure stimulation plus one that was formerly associated with a threat. The researchers think this indicates that stressed people overgeneralize their particular mental knowledge — whether or not they aren’t in fact risky.
